Ukraine’s ‘Equalizer’ bomb aims to blow up reliance on US, European weapons

Ukraine developed a homegrown glide bomb called Vyrivniuvach, or "Equalizer," designed by DG Industry to allow pilots to strike Russian forces from safer distances. This new weapon aims to reduce Kyiv's reliance on foreign supplies such as U.S.-supplied JDAM-ER kits and French-made Hammer bombs. The ability to use this domestically produced bomb provides more control over guided ordnance, even though some chips and microcircuits still come from abroad.
